Do Ceramic Paint Additives Work

Does ceramic insulating paint work?

No matter that engineers and architects long ago debunked it, insulating paint still occasionally finds its way into buildings. Powdered ceramic chips that can be added to any paint are said to reflect heat in or out of a building and reduce heat loss by staggering amounts.

What does additives do in paint?

Paint additives are used to prevent defects in the coating (e.g., foam bubbles, poor leveling, flocculation, sedi- mentation) or to impart specific properties to the paint (e.g.. better slip, flame retardance, UV stability) that are otherwise difficult to achieve.

Does heat reflective paint work?

No, heat reflective paint is ineffective when used indoors. If the paint has no exposure to sunlight, then it won’t perform. The only product that can really keep energy within a building is bulk insulation. Clearly, then, it takes much more than a thin layer of paint to radiate energy.

What are surface active additives?

The term surfactant is derived from the phrase “surface active agent.” Surfactants reduce the surface tension between two liquids and the interfacial tension between a liquid and a solid. This reduction leads to an increase in spreading and wetting capability, giving much better cleaning results.

What is the role of binders in paint?

Paint binders are used to firmly attach the pigment to the surface and into a continuous film. The type and quantity of binder used in the paint impacts performance factors, such as durability, stain resistance, adhesion, and resistance to cracking.

Is heat reflective paint on residence roof Effective?

Reflective Roof-Top Coating can reduce ceiling heat. A white reflective roof coating can potentially reduce up to 60% of heat coming in from the ceiling. But the results vary in different situations. With various experiments, researchers have found savings to vary from 20% to 60%.

Can you insulate a wall with paint?

Whereas savings in cost and heat are easy to measure in conventional insulation techniques, it is impossible with thermal insulation paint. Using just the paint, you would have to have a layer of around 200mm to get the wall down to somewhere close to building regulations.

How do you fix paint that won’t stick?

Surface Prep Most paints won’t adhere to an oily, greasy, slick or glossy surface, but these problems can be prevented by cleaning or sanding, reveals Sherwin-Williams. Unless you plan on using a peel-stopping primer, flaking or peeling paint must be completely scraped off.

How do you get paint to stick to surface?

Ordinary paint won’t stick to slick surfaces, like glossy paint, clear finishes, metal, Formica®, cabinets, paneling or tile. By applying a quality primer to the surface first, your paint will not only stick to the surface, but your paint job will last longer and won’t crack, peel or blister over time.
